So, which type of data can Splunk monitor from text files? Is it just network data or script outputs, or could it be something more? Spoiler alert: the right answer is files and directories. Yup! Splunk is equipped to track, analyze, and index all sorts of data from text files, making it a powerhouse for data management.

You see, when we mention text files, we’re talking about more than just a few lines of code. We’re referring to any files and directories that house valuable log or text-based data formats. Think about all those log files generated daily by applications or system processes. Wouldn’t it be incredible to have a system that continuously monitors these files? That’s where Splunk shines.

By keeping tabs on files and directories, Splunk enables real-time analysis and alerting based on their contents. Picture this: you have a log file from your database that tracks user activities. Splunk can give you the insights you need at a moment’s notice. This capability to monitor log files centrally is crucial for organizations aiming to streamline their logging and data analysis processes.

Now, you might wonder why other options don’t quite hit the mark. Network data and script outputs are significant, but they serve specific contexts. They lack the broad applicability of monitoring all text file sources. The idea that Splunk can deal with "all data types" is a bit misleading because Splunk really excels at handling structured and text-based data.

Whether it's system files or configuration files, Splunk's versatility in data ingestion provides a comprehensive solution for tracking changes, additions, or updates.
